An empirical study on reliability evaluation for a real time switching system
We present an empirical model to evaluate reliability of a large software system. We take as a target system a large real-time switching system which is under development in our research institute. The results obtained from our reliability model indicate that there is close relation between software failures collected during the development of the system and reliability of the system. We also analyze, through a statistical analysis of the observed failure data, the development procedure and reliabilities of respective subsystems constituting the target system in order to investigate the effects of individual reliabilities of the subsystems on the state of the whole system. The results show both relationships among subsystem groups and the dependencies between subsystems and the whole system. Our empirical reliability model can be used as a reference model to study the reliability of real-time systems similar to ours in functional structure.
